BEIJING, Feb. 11 (Xinhua) -- Reigning Olympic champion Suzanne Schulting of the Netherlands renewed the world record to one minute and 26.514 seconds in the women's 1,000 meter short track speedskating quarterfinals at the Beijing Winter Olympics on Friday.

The previous world record was 1:26.661 set by South Korea's Shim Suk-hee in a World Cup race in Calgary in 2012.
